John Rowe

John Rowe Email and Phone Number

Engineering Leader @ Meta - Business Messaging @ Meta
John Rowe's Location
Greater Minneapolis-St. Paul Area, United States, United States
John Rowe's Contact Details

John Rowe personal email

About John Rowe

I've been lucky enough in my career to be able to make an impact across a large variety of areas including business messaging, planet-scale infrastructure, e-commerce, voice assistants, API security and integrations, and business customer tooling. As a manager, I love focusing on helping folks along in their own career journeys while making work fulfilling. As a leader, I'm always looking on how to make a positive impact on both the company and, more importantly, the world at large. At Meta, I've had the privilege of working on projects that positively impact the experience of billions of people across the globe while driving tens of billions of dollars in new revenue.I love chatting with new people, hearing their unique experiences and being a resource to help folks out. Feel free to reach out if you want to chat!

John Rowe's Current Company Details
Meta

Meta

View
Engineering Leader @ Meta - Business Messaging
John Rowe Work Experience Details
  • Meta
    Software Engineering Manager
    Meta May 2022 - Present
    Menlo Park, Ca, Us
    Led multiple engineering teams in the Business Messaging area including Product Managers, Product Designers, User-Experience Researchers, Data Scientists, Business Product Managers and Product Marketing ManagersCreated product strategies for 0->1 projects across Monetization, WhatsApp, Instagram and Messenger orgs and drove executionLed the product strategy and execution of incorporating messaging features into Meta’s Ads Manager leading to significant incremental revenue gainsCreated and executed on growth strategy for the WhatsApp Business APIOwned integration platform that supported multi-billion revenue across B2B partnershipsResponsible for all cross-team quality and cultural programs across a 100+ engineer organization and collaborated on those programs with other leads across a 600+ engineer organizationProvided coaching to multiple senior engineers and other engineering managers outside of reporting chainCreated the Mobile Ninjas program that cross-trained over 50 web engineers to mobile development to close key resource gap across Business Messaging
  • Best Buy
    Director Of Engineering
    Best Buy Mar 2017 - Apr 2022
    Richfield, Minnesota, Us
    Leading an engineering organization consisting of engineering managers, software engineers, quality assurance engineers, devops engineers, designers and product managers in the creation of a range of exciting productsDesigned, built and implemented multiple enterprise integration patterns and customer identity solutions using technologies and standards such as AWS API Gateway, Zuul, Spring Cloud Gateway, Oauth2, mTLS, HMAC, GraphQL and Kerberos as a way to provide multiple teams self-service platforms to increase their flow.Created and implemented multiple security solutions around identity management, bot mitigation, multiple identity consolidation, network layer AuthN/AuthZ, application layer AuthN/AuthZ, PCI compliance, PHI compliance, Zero Trust, service meshes, token exchange, cloud security, and datacenter securityEmployed engineering practices such as iterative design, continuous integration, test driven development, test automation, pair programming, devops, infrastructure as code and full support ownership on all of my teamsArchitected and implemented a dynamic cache strategy that vastly increased response time for mobile usersTransitioned from monolithic applications to a micro service architecture deployed in Docker containersUsed AWS Lambdas to deploy serverless backend servicesDeployed and supported applications written in Java, Groovy, Scalia and JavaScript
  • Target
    Senior Software Engineer
    Target Apr 2015 - Mar 2017
    Minneapolis, Mn, Us
    Leading a team of engineers in architecting and implementing a new data movement strategy across the entire enterprise.Responsible for devising coding standards, release management strategy, automated unit testing strategy and automated build framework.Implemented an open source big data platform using technologies such as Apache Storm, Apache Kafka and Apache Camel in both Linux and Windows Server environments.Worked in both the scrum master and engineering roles as part of an agile scrum team.Implemented an application monitoring system for a production cloud environment.Created and maintained high-availability APIs with Spring Hibernate.Created and managed over 2,000 production servers with Chef.Provided a ready to use CI/CD platform using Jenkins DSL for teams across the enterprise for both Java/Groovy applications as well as Chef cookbooks.
  • Lockheed Martin
    Software Engineer
    Lockheed Martin Jun 2011 - Apr 2015
    Bethesda, Md, Us
    Provided on-site customer support for major releases.Developed new practices for ensuring that ERAM software development could be more efficient.Led various software teams in implementing modern software practices to drive down the cost for the customer.Led a team of 8 software engineers on the ERAM FLTS team ensuring that all code was delivered on time, at original SLOC estimates and fully tested.Implemented various automated test procedures that were applied across the program due to their effectiveness.Worked on a large investment prototype which used an agile process and modern software tools.
  • Lockheed Martin
    Engineering Leadership Development Program (Eldp)
    Lockheed Martin Jun 2011 - Apr 2014
    Bethesda, Md, Us
    First Rotation: June 2011 - August 2011, On site customer support for ERAM roll-out to key FAA sitesSecond Rotation: August 2011 - October 2012, Software Engineer for ERAMThird Rotation: October 2012 - March 2013, Software Engineer working on a large investment prototypeFourth Rotation: March 2013 - Present, FLS software lead and FLTS AIMS lead on ERAMAs part of a special project, I designed and built an SQL database with a web interface using the J2EE Spring framework. The project was in response to a need for a large-scale Earned Value Management tracking system and is now in use on a billion dollar program.
  • Lockheed Martin
    Software Engineer Asc
    Lockheed Martin May 2009 - Jun 2011
    Bethesda, Md, Us
    Designed and maintained Access databases across various business unitsUsed both SQL and Visual Basic to create new databases from requirementsSupported the FLTS software team on the ERAM program developing mainly in Ada and C++Developed, tested and delivered code to support both new development and prior releases from high level design to delivery.
  • Daktronics
    Hardware Engineering Intern
    Daktronics May 2008 - Dec 2008
    Brookings, Sd, Us
    Wrote firmware for both Xilinx and Altera FPGAs to work with both new components as well as be controlled by a microprocessor code I wrote in VHDL.Part of an engineering emergency team that quickly responded to customer issues by traveling across the globe.Determined engineering hardware needs were and presented suggestions to senior management on various suppliers.

John Rowe Skills

.net Git Linux Systems Engineering C Assembly Language Matlab Air Traffic Control Electronics Jenkins Agile Methodologies Apache Kafka Team Leadership Scrum Eclipse Powershell Apache Camel Java Embedded Systems C++ Software Engineering Apache Storm Intellij Idea Github

John Rowe Education Details

  • The Johns Hopkins University
    The Johns Hopkins University
    Systems Engineering
  • North Dakota State University
    North Dakota State University
    Electrical Engineering

Frequently Asked Questions about John Rowe

What company does John Rowe work for?

John Rowe works for Meta

What is John Rowe's role at the current company?

John Rowe's current role is Engineering Leader @ Meta - Business Messaging.

What is John Rowe's email address?

John Rowe's email address is jo****@****get.com

What is John Rowe's direct phone number?

John Rowe's direct phone number is +170172*****

What schools did John Rowe attend?

John Rowe attended The Johns Hopkins University, North Dakota State University.

What skills is John Rowe known for?

John Rowe has skills like .net, Git, Linux, Systems Engineering, C, Assembly Language, Matlab, Air Traffic Control, Electronics, Jenkins, Agile Methodologies, Apache Kafka.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.